Meaning of "protection extends"

protection extends: This phrase typically refers to the idea that protection or safeguarding measures are prolonged or expanded to cover a wider scope or range. It can be used in contexts related to laws, policies, or agreements that aim to ensure safety and security for individuals, groups, or entities
